Biography

Anthea Butler is the Geraldine R. Segal Professor of American Social Thought and chair of the Department of Religious Studies at the University of Pennsylvania. Her research and writing focus on African American religion, nationalism, race, politics, evangelicalism, gender, sexuality, media, and popular culture. Professor Butler is a historian whose recent works include the book 'White Evangelical Racism: Politics and Morality in America' and 'Women, Church, God, Christ: Making a Sanctified World', published by University of North Carolina Press. She contributed to the 1619 Project with a chapter titled 'Church' and is known for her public engagement as a commentator for MSNBC and other major media outlets. Butler is a member of various professional organizations, including the American Academy of Religion and the American Historical Association, and has received numerous accolades, including the Martin E. Marty Award for Public Understanding of Religion. She is currently involved in research about prosperity gospel politics in the American-Nigerian context and is accepting applicants for her Doctoral Program in Religious Studies.
